Reduce machine, cluster charts to single instances
[icn.git] / deploy / cluster / templates / cluster.yaml
similarity index 57%
rename from deploy/clusters/templates/cluster.yaml
rename to deploy/cluster/templates/cluster.yaml
index bee2940..c507750 100644 (file)
@@ -1,26 +1,24 @@
-{{- range $clusterName, $cluster := .Values.clusters }}
 ---
 apiVersion: cluster.x-k8s.io/v1alpha4
 kind: Cluster
 metadata:
   labels:
-    cluster.x-k8s.io/cluster-name: {{ $clusterName }}
-    {{- toYaml $cluster.clusterLabels | nindent 4 }}
-  name: {{ $clusterName }}
+    cluster.x-k8s.io/cluster-name: {{ .Values.clusterName }}
+    {{- toYaml .Values.clusterLabels | nindent 4 }}
+  name: {{ .Values.clusterName }}
 spec:
   clusterNetwork:
     pods:
       cidrBlocks:
-      - {{ $cluster.podCidr }}
+      - {{ .Values.podCidr }}
     services:
       cidrBlocks:
       - 10.244.0.0/18
   controlPlaneRef:
     apiVersion: controlplane.cluster.x-k8s.io/v1alpha4
     kind: KubeadmControlPlane
-    name: {{ $clusterName }}
+    name: {{ .Values.clusterName }}
   infrastructureRef:
     apiVersion: infrastructure.cluster.x-k8s.io/v1alpha5
     kind: Metal3Cluster
-    name: {{ $clusterName }}
-{{- end }}
+    name: {{ .Values.clusterName }}